Abstract: An album of 130 albumen photgraphs by
Robert Macpherson of Greek and Roman sculpture held in the Vatican Museum, along with
installation views of six of the halls housing the sculpture. The album documents the museum
as it was arranged in the 1860s.

Biographical / Historical
Robert MacPherson was a Scottish painter turned photographer and some-time art dealer,
active in Rome from 1851 until his death. While he produced views of Rome's classical ruins,
churches, fountains, piazzas and villas, and of the Roman Campagna and surrounding towns,
McPherson's main interest was in photographing sculpture. He was the first to photograph the
interior of the Vatican palace, and he had ambitions to photograph not only all of the
Vatican's significant sculptures, but all of the major sculpture collections in Rome.
In 1863 MacPherson published his
Vatican Sculptures, Selected and
Arranged in the Order in Which They Are Found in the Galleries
(London: Chapman
& Hall) containing 125 wood engravings based on his photographs by his wife, Geralidine.
At the same time he issued an album of 126 photographs of Vatican sculptures.

Scope and Content of Collection
The album contains 126 albumen photographs by Robert Macpherson of Greek and Roman
sculpture held in the Vatican Museum ( Museo Pio-Clementino). The album is organized by the
halls in which the sculptures are displayed, and installation views of six of the halls
(Braccio Nuovo, Chiaramonte, Hall of the Animals, Hall of Statues, Hall of the Greek Cross,
and the Hall of the Candelabra) precede the images of their respective contents. The album
documents the museum as it was arranged in the 1860s.
The album is velum-bound with a gilt-stamped red leather title plate on its spine which
also has banding and the photographer's name directly gilt-stamped onto it. An inventory
number (?) is inked above the title plate. The back paste-down bears a shelf label:
Accession No. 3744; Date 1901. The album was assembled and bound for the Museum of Fine
Arts, Boston.
A list entitled "Macpherson's Vatican Sculptures, Printed and Published in London by Emily
Faithful," serves as the title page to the album. Numbers pencilled on the mounts below the
images correspond to this inventory, and the titles of the individual photgraphs are taken
directly from this list. Nine mounts bear the blind stamp: R. McPherson / Rome (in an oval
border with photograph number pencilled in the center of the oval).
The versos of the mounts bear the Boston Museum of Fine Arts wet stamp in their centers: M.
F. A. (enclosed in an oval), and printed M. F. A. labels, with the object number inked in,
are adhered to the upper left corners, occasionally with annotations pencilled next to
them.
